Counter-Strike 2 CPU Benchmark - 960 FPS - 7950X3D + RTX 4090

Поделиться
HTML-код
  • Опубликовано: 22 авг 2024
  • PC Config : imgur.com/aZ1nQMx
    CPU : 7950X3D in 7800X3D mode (only 3D V-Cache cores enabled)
    CCD0 - 5.40 GHz, 8/8 (103x52.5), SMT OFF, CO -30
    CCD1 - Disabled
    Asus X670E GENE
    DDR5-6200 @ 26-36-36-30
    RTX 4090 @ 3000 MHz
    Optimus FOUNDATION waterblock + MO-RA3 420 radiator
